i put a new carb on my 84 camaro and now it has a hesitation when i accelerate .its the same oe carb.my car is computer type.everything is hooked up the same as before. i have checked for vacum leaks and tried adjusting the mixture screws which helped some but still some hesitation on take off. it idles great and cruses smooth.the carb is the tps sensor type.
